Lexington Attractions You Canโ€™t Miss

Exploring Lexington reveals attractions that show off the area’s spirit and culture. Keeneland Race Course is a top spot, being a National Historic Landmark. It gives a peek into thoroughbred racing and Kentucky’s horse heritage.

The Mary Todd Lincoln House is another must-see. It sheds light on Mary Todd, President Abraham Lincoln’s wife. The mansion, restored to its former glory, tells stories of 19th-century life and the Todd family’s impact on Lexington.

The Kentucky Bourbon Trail is a key attraction too. It takes you through bourbon country, visiting famous distilleries. Here, you can enjoy tastings and tours that are both fun and educational.

Iconic Sights in Lexington

To truly get to know Lexington, you must see its iconic sights. Begin at historic Ashland, the Henry Clay Estate. Here, you can learn about one of Kentucky’s most important figures. Then, head to the Mary Todd Lincoln House to discover the early life of the First Lady.

Don’t miss the Kentucky Theatre. It’s not just a place to watch classic films. It’s also a symbol of Lexington’s lively culture. Plus, the city’s murals add a modern touch, making your visit unforgettable. These sights are key to exploring Lexington in just 2 days.

Eating and Dining in Lexington

Lexington has a lively food scene that matches the city’s charm. When you check out dining in Lexington, you’ll find local foods like burgoo, hot browns, and finger-licking BBQ. These dishes are made with fresh, local ingredients, making every meal unforgettable.

Local Cuisine you Need to Try

Here are some top picks from Lexington’s local food scene:

  • Burgoo – A hearty stew filled with meats and veggies.
  • Hot Brown – An open-faced sandwich with turkey, Mornay sauce, tomatoes, and bacon.
  • BBQ – Different regional styles cater to every BBQ fan.

These dishes are just a glimpse of what Lexington offers. Diving into this food culture makes your visit even better.
